Clár na nÁbhar[Folaigh][Taispeáin]
Dia duit gach duine, agus fáilte roimh ré nua na hintleachta saorga. Tá ríomhchláraitheoirí ar fud an domhain tar éis tosú ag cruthú “gníomhairí uathrialacha” a chomhoibríonn le samhlacha móra teanga (LLManna) cosúil le GPT-4 OpenAI chun dul i ngleic le saincheisteanna dúshlánacha.
Cé go bhfuil siad fós thar a bheith óg, d’fhéadfadh gníomhairí den sórt sin a bheith ina gcéim shuntasach chun tosaigh in úsáid rathúil LLM. De ghnáth, déanaimid cumarsáid le GPT-4 trí threoracha a chumadh go cúramach agus iad a chur isteach i mbosca téacs ChatGPT go dtí go bhfreagraíonn an tsamhail leis an toradh inmhianaithe.
Go ginearálta, is féidir le gníomhairí uathrialacha sraith gníomhartha córasacha a ghiniúint a dhéanann an LLM go dtí go sroicheann sé “sprioc” réamhshocraithe. Áirítear ar fhairsinge na ngníomhaíochtaí a bhfuil gníomhairí uathrialacha in ann a dhéanamh anois taighde gréasáin, códú, achoimre, cruthú ábhar bunaidh, aistriúchán, agus go leor eile.
Tháinig roinnt córas hintleachta saorga, cosúil le Google's Bard agus OpenAI's ChatGPT, GPT-4, chun cinn le déanaí agus scaipeadh iad ar fud na cruinne. Tháinig Bing Bot nua ó Microsoft le feiceáil freisin.
Tá córas AI breise ar a dtugtar BabyAGI tar éis dul isteach sa tsraith córais AI seo.
San Airteagal seo, déanfaimid breathnú domhain ar BabyAGI, a chomhpháirt ríthábhachtach, agus conas a fheidhmíonn sé ón taobh istigh amach. Déanfaimid é a chur i gcomparáid le AutoGPT, agus ansin léiríonn tú conas é a shuiteáil agus é a úsáid ar do ríomhaire.
Mar sin, cad é LeanbhAGI?
Is ardán urghnách hintleachta saorga (AI) é BabyAGI atá deartha go dian chun raon leathan gníomhairí AI a thástáil agus a fhorbairt sa timpeallacht fhíorúil. Yohei Nakajima, máistir caipitil fiontair agus hintleachta saorga, is é cruthaitheoir an aireagáin cheannródaíoch seo.
Bunaithe ar ailtireacht leathan BabyAGI, tá ardán foinse oscailte ag an nGníomhaire Uathrialach Tasc-Thiomanta chun taighde a chur chun cinn i réimsí éagsúla, ó shealbhú teanga agus forbairt chognaíoch go foghlaim atreisithe.
Tá BabyAGI deartha chun aithris a dhéanamh ar an bhfoghlaim ar bhealach atá cosúil le forbairt chognaíoch na leanaí. Is é an cuspóir deiridh ná cumhacht a thabhairt do AI eolas a fháil trí thaithí, breithiúnais ciallmhara a dhéanamh, agus gníomhú go neamhspleách.
Tá na féidearthachtaí gan teorainn agus BabyAGI chun tosaigh i dtaighde ceannródaíoch AI.
Is é príomhsprioc an ardáin seo ná measúnú agus feabhas a chur ar fheidhmíocht raon leathan gníomhairí AI ag baint úsáide as socruithe, oiliúint agus measúnuithe insamhladh. Is é an príomhchuspóir atá aige ná cumas na ngníomhairí chun tascanna dúshlánacha a fhoghlaim agus a chomhlíonadh a fhiosrú.
Is léir go bhfuil forbairt na foghlama treisithe gníomhairí agus cumas cognaíocha ina chuid ríthábhachtach de rath an ardáin.
Anois, cad atá faoi chochall BabyAGI?
Úsáideann an córas cuid de na teicneolaíochtaí is cumhachtaí atá ar fáil, lena n-áirítear GPT-4, cumais slabhra agus gníomhaire LangChain, API OpenAI, agus Pinecone, chun cur i gcrích tapa agus éifeachtach tascanna a chumasú.
Gan amhras, is é an tsamhail teanga GPT-4, LLM gan mheaitseáil a cruthaíodh chun poist a láimhseáil le cruinneas agus le háisiúlacht, croí buailte an chórais. Is féidir leis an gcóras jabanna casta a dhéanamh le héifeachtacht gan sárú mar gheall ar a chumas tascanna nua a ghiniúint agus iad a chur in ord tosaíochta i bhfíor-am.
Ina theannta sin, baineann an córas úsáid as Pinecone, ardán cuardaigh veicteora, atá ríthábhachtach maidir le sonraí a bhaineann le tascanna a stóráil agus a aisghabháil amhail cur síos ar thasc, srianta agus torthaí.
Chun go mbeidh an córas in ann foghlaim atreisithe, a cheadaíonn dó eolas a fháil ó thaithí agus dul i bhfeabhas le himeacht ama, tá gá le cur chuige simplithe maidir le láimhseáil sonraí. Tá creat LangChain comhtháite ag an gcóras, ag réabhlóidiú ar an mbealach a idirghníomhaíonn gníomhairí AI lena dtimpeallacht in iarracht teorainneacha cumais Baby AGI a thástáil.
Seasann an córas amach ó na hiomaitheoirí mar gheall ar an leibhéal ardaithe rannpháirtíochta seo, rud a chabhraíonn leis an ngníomhaire AI a bheith níos feasaí ar shonraí agus a threalmhú chun poist dhúshlánacha a láimhseáil gan stró.
Úsáideann an córas deque (scuaine dúbailte) struchtúr sonraí a liosta post a eagrú agus a chur in ord tosaíochta toisc go bhfuil bainistíocht tasc mar bhunús le cumais Baby AGI.
Táirgeann an córas tascanna nua go huathoibríoch chun an liosta tascanna a choinneáil reatha agus cothrom le dáta nuair a chríochnaítear tascanna agus nuair a chruthaítear cinn nua ina n-áit. Déantar an liosta tascanna a aththosaíocht go rialta chun a chinntiú go bhfeidhmíonn an córas chomh héifeachtach agus is féidir, rud a chuirfidh ar a chumas dualgais a chomhlíonadh gan earráid.
Conas a oibríonn BabyAGI?
Roghnaíonn script BabyAGI tascanna go leanúnach ó liosta tascanna, déanann sé iad a fhorghníomhú, feabhsaíonn sé na torthaí, agus gineann sé tascanna nua ag brath ar sprioc agus toradh an phoist roimhe sin.
Ritheann an script seo i lúb gan teorainn. Is iad na ceithre phríomhchéim de shreabhadh oibre na scripte ná cur i gcrích tascanna, saibhriú torthaí, giniúint tasc, agus beartú tosaíochta tascanna.
Forghníomhú tasc
Tosaíonn próiseas BabyAGI leis an gcéim seo. Tarchuireann feidhm an ghníomhaire forghníomhaithe tasc chuig API OpenAI sa chéim seo, agus críochnaíonn an API an post de réir an chomhthéacs. Is é an cuspóir agus an tasc an dá ionchur d'fheidhm an ghníomhaire forghníomhaithe.
Seoltar toradh an taisc ar ais ansin mar theaghrán tar éis leid a sheoladh chuig API OpenAI. Tá an chéim seo tábhachtach toisc go dtugann sé deis don chóras tascanna a chríochnú agus faisnéis a bhailiú a chabhróidh le tascanna nua a fhorbairt agus le cúraimí reatha a chur in ord tosaíochta.
Feabhsú ar thorthaí
Sa chéim ar a dtugtar “feabhas ar thorthaí,” feabhsaítear agus caomhnaítear toradh an phoist roimhe seo in Pinecone, uirlis chabhrach chun torthaí tascanna a chartlannú agus a aisghabháil lena n-úsáid níos déanaí. Tá an próiseas seo ríthábhachtach toisc go gceadaíonn sé don chóras a fheidhmíocht a fheabhsú i gcónaí trí fhoghlaim ó bhotúin san am atá caite.
Is féidir le BabyAGI treochtaí a aimsiú, foghlaim ó bhotúin, agus a fheidhmíocht a fheabhsú sna tascanna seo a leanas trí súil a choinneáil ar thorthaí roimhe seo agus ar na meiteashonraí a théann leo.
Giniúint tasc
Is é cruthú tascanna an tríú céim sa phróiseas BabyAGI, áit a n-úsáideann feidhm an ghníomhaire cruthú tascanna API OpenAI chun tascanna nua a ghiniúint ag brath ar sprioc agus toradh an phoist roimhe seo.
Cuireann an fheidhm iarratas chuig an OpenAI API le ceithre pharaiméadar: an cuspóir, toradh an taisc roimhe seo, an cur síos ar an tasc, agus an liosta tascanna reatha. Freagraíonn an API le liosta de thascanna nua mar teaghráin. Seoltar liosta foclóirí ar a bhfuil ainmneacha na dtascanna nua ar ais ansin in éineacht leis na tascanna nua.
Tús áite a thabhairt do na tascanna
Is é tosaíocht tascanna an chéim dheireanach den sreabhadh oibre do BabyAGI. Tugtar tosaíocht don liosta tascanna sa chás seo agus feidhm an ghníomhaire tosaíochta ag baint úsáide as an OpenAI API. Is féidir ID an taisc reatha a sheoladh mar pharaiméadar don fheidhm.
Tugann an fheidhm liosta uimhrithe de thascanna a ndearnadh aththosaíocht orthu tar éis leid a sheoladh chuig API OpenAI. Tá an chéim seo riachtanach chun a chinntiú go leanann an córas ag díriú ar ghníomhaíochtaí atá suntasach agus a bhaineann leis an sprioc.
Conas BabyGPT a shuiteáil agus a úsáid ar do mheaisín?
Réamhriachtanais
Tá roinnt riachtanas ann a chaithfidh tú a shuiteáil ar do ríomhaire sula gcuirfimid tús leis an bpróiseas suiteála:
- dul
- Python 3.8 nó níos déanaí
- Eochair OpenAI API
- Eochair API PineCone
Tabhair faoi deara: Tá MacOS á úsáid agam leis an leagan is déanaí.
Clón an stór BabyAGI
Mar chéad chéim, déan fillteán uathúil (BabyAGI) ar do ríomhaire. Chun an tionscadal a chlónáil, oscail Git Bash agus cuir isteach an t-ordú seo a leanas:
Spleáchasanna a shuiteáil
Sa chéim seo bogadh chuig an bhfillteán a cruthaíodh díreach, cuirfimid na spleáchais go léir a theastaíonn chun BabyAGI a reáchtáil.
Tar éis sin oscail an tionscadal i d'eagarthóir cód, táim ag baint úsáide as VSCode, rename.env.template to.env, agus líon suas na réimsí le do chuid eochracha OpenAI agus PineCone API.
Is féidir d’eochair OpenAI API a fháil anseo
Is féidir d'eochair API Pinecone a fháil anseo.
Ar deireadh, cuir na APIanna sin i gcomhad .env i réimsí a bhfuil meas orthu.
Sa chomhad céanna, gheobhaidh tú tasc oibiachtúil agus tosaigh.
Rith an script Python
Ag an gcéim dheireanach, is féidir leat an Script Python ó d'eagarthóir cód nó fiú leis an teirminéal. Is leatsa an rogha. Seo torthaí an BabyAGI.
BabyAGI vs AutoGPT
Tá difríocht idir BabyAGI agus Auto-GPT ar bhealaí áirithe, lena n-áirítear an bealach a bhailíonn sé faisnéis. Ní chuireann BabyAGI cuardach ar acmhainní seachtracha, rud a d'fhéadfadh a bheith ina bhuntáiste mór i gcásanna áirithe i gcomparáid le Auto-GPT.
Seachnaíonn BabyAGI éirí as an mbóthar trí theorannú a dhíriú ar ransú smaointe agus staonann sé ó bheith ag lorg faisnéise ar líne.
Mar gheall ar a mhodheolaíocht nuálaíoch, is uirlis iontach é BabyAGI le haghaidh smaointe agus ransú smaointe.
Is féidir le BabyAGI teacht suas go héasca le smaointe bunaidh a bhuíochas dá dhíriú tiomanta ar smaoineamh, cibé an n-úsáidtear é mar fheidhmchlár neamhspleách nó mar chomhpháirt laistigh de chóras níos mó.
Is féidir le BabyAGI torthaí gan mheaitseáil a sholáthar trí seachráin a sheachaint agus fócas cosúil le léasair a choinneáil ar an obair atá idir lámha, rud a fhágann gur uirlis ríthábhachtach é i réimse an taighde agus na forbartha AI.
Conclúid
Is é príomhphrionsabal fhealsúnacht dearaidh BabyAGI comhtháthú uathoibrithe, faisnéis agus éifeachtúlacht gan uaim, rud a chuireann ar chumas úsáideoirí raon leathan constaicí a láimhseáil go héasca i saol an lae inniu atá ag athrú go tapa.
Is féidir leat leas a bhaint go héasca as cumas an ardáin le haghaidh réiteach tascanna uathoibrithe agus bainistíocht a bhuíochas dá mhodh simplí socraithe agus forghníomhaithe, rud a fhágann gur comhghuaillíocht iontach é do dhaoine aonair agus d’fhoirne araon.
Is cinnte go n-éireoidh uirlisí cosúil le BabyAGI níos tábhachtaí de réir mar a fhorbraíonn agus a fhásann taighde AI, ag cuidiú leis an todhchaí a mhúnlú. Tá BabyAGI in ann a bheith ina ardán ceannródaíoch don chruthaitheacht atá á gcumhachtú ag AI, ag cothú nuálaíochta agus dul chun cinn i ngnólachtaí agus gairmeacha éagsúla a bhuí leis an mbéim gan mhacasamhail atá aige ar ransú smaointe agus smaointe.
Agus a chumais cheannródaíocha, spreagfar an chéad ghlúin eile de tháirgí faoi thiomáint AI, rud a chuirfidh ar chumas eagraíochtaí agus daoine araon a gcuspóirí a bhaint amach ar bhealach níos cliste agus níos éifeachtaí ná riamh.
Jane
Alt iontach! Go raibh maith agat as rang teagaisc a phostáil le haghaidh seo ní féidir fanacht chun triail a bhaint as! Conas is féidir liom an tionscadal a oscailt i VS?
Jay
Tarraing agus scaoil an fillteán isteach i gCód VS.